Grantseeking Associate

National Association of State Public Interest Research Groups
Los Angeles, CA

With public debate around important issues often dominated by special interests pursuing their own narrow agenda, the State Public Interest Research Groups (PIRGs) offer an independent, articulate voice on behalf of the public interest. For 28 years, our mission has been to serve as a public interest "watchdog", uncovering new threats to the environment, consumers and a responsible government; researching and proposing innovative policy solutions; educating and engaging citizens and decision-makers; organizing grassroots support for strong environmental and consumer protection; and working to counter the influence of vested economic interests on state and national institutions.

JOB DESCRIPTION
Working with the National Development Department of the State PIRGs, the Grantseeking Associate will become part of the team campaigning protect the environment and public interest. The Grantseeking Associate will work side-by-side with the organization's Development staff to assist the grantseeking efforts of environmental and public interest advocates, attorneys, organizers and scientists across the country. The Grantseeking Associate's respon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:

  • Grantseeking Assistance. The Grantseeking Associate will work with staff across the country to develop and implement strategic grantseeking plans to raise money for environmental and public interest projects.
  • Foundation Targeting. The Grantseeking Associate will research, identify and assign appropriate foundation targets for state PIRG and affiliated project staff.
  • Proposal Writing and Editing. The Grantseeking Associate will draft and edit proposals on environmental, consumer and good government issues for PIRG and affiliated organizations.
  • Clearinghouse. The Grantseeking Associate will help to maintain an extensive database on current and prospective funders and provide information to grantseekers about these foundations upon request.

LOCATION:
Los Angeles, CA.

QUALIFICATIONS:
Candidates must possess excellent written and verbal skills and should have experience in database management. Experience working with a public interest advocacy organization or political campaign experience is preferred, but not required.

SALARY & BENEFITS:
Salary ranges from $18,000 to $35,000 depending on experience. An outstanding benefits package includes health care, educational loan assistance for qualified staff, a retirement plan, paid vacation and sick days, parental leave, and, in some locations, a dependent care assistance program. Opportunities for advancement, travel, and additional training are available.
